From patchwork Thu Jan 17 16:38:15 2019 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Stefan Schaeckeler X-Patchwork-Id: 1026805 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from lists.ozlabs.org (lists.ozlabs.org [203.11.71.2]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(2048 bits) server-digest SHA256)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 43gVLz4PxHz9sBZ for ; Fri, 18 Jan 2019 03:45:47 +1100 (AEDT) Authentication-Results: ozlabs.org; dmarc=none (p=none dis=none) header.from=gmx.net Received: from lists.ozlabs.org (lists.ozlabs.org [IPv6:2401:3900:2:1::3]) by lists.ozlabs.org (Postfix) with ESMTP id 43gVLz2s23zDqwV for ; Fri, 18 Jan 2019 03:45:47 +1100 (AEDT) X-Original-To: linux-aspeed@lists.ozlabs.org Delivered-To: linux-aspeed@lists.ozlabs.org Authentication-Results: lists.ozlabs.org; spf=pass (mailfrom) smtp.mailfrom=gmx.net (client-ip=212.227.15.15; helo=mout.gmx.net; envelope-from=schaecsn@gmx.net; receiver=) Authentication-Results: lists.ozlabs.org; dmarc=none (p=none dis=none) header.from=gmx.net Received: from mout.gmx.net (mout.gmx.net [212.227.15.15]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by lists.ozlabs.org (Postfix) with ESMTPS id 43gVLs0pXMzDqWg for ; Fri, 18 Jan 2019 03:45:38 +1100 (AEDT) Received: from corona.crabdance.com ([173.228.106.209]) by mail.gmx.com (mrgmx003 [212.227.17.190]) with ESMTPSA (Nemesis) id 0M1n4s-1h4RLh0Q1a-00to4X; Thu, 17 Jan 2019 17:39:51 +0100 Received: by corona.crabdance.com (Postfix, from userid 1001) id 31DA16E85603; Thu, 17 Jan 2019 08:39:43 -0800 (PST) From: Stefan Schaeckeler To: Rob Herring , Mark Rutland , Joel Stanley , Andrew Jeffery , Borislav Petkov , Mauro Carvalho Chehab , linux-kernel@vger.kernel.org, dev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-aspeed@lists.ozlabs.org, linux-edac@vger.kernel.org Subject: [PATCH v2 0/2] Add support for the Aspeed AST2500 SoC EDAC driver Date: Thu, 17 Jan 2019 08:38:15 -0800 Message-Id: <1547743097-5236-1-git-send-email-schaecsn@gmx.net> X-Mailer: git-send-email 2.4.5 X-Provags-ID: V03:K1:GKo1VKn9KyeZV/UCPikGLJBxMv/BIpGyn9BpU807KE2eSsNdoQu xg8U5TgIwPoGsZkxB6r7aBgjNNUH/moY42AYjlJ2Zp7VaBbMxbAsgINBqjA1to9qmPs8hco TD57GxlxlDkKuEpn5eQuz/lJMlLB2edaNZNzBTFMX2w4grJEmU58SwBrAg/4Caa7EJjwTrE 26RyJjqj/xDxcxqxd6JMQ== X-Spam-Flag: NO X-UI-Out-Filterresults: notjunk:1; V03:K0:ROE5glx1ylU=:P5NqdVI2SrpEY+Mj/Mua9S xMeJUViMX8tt0eNUMgHhbibUH6Cks1KMvzQMG1GhdohLvnGTqb3Pdhj8yZQZ2fBF8C8GzM9+E dacOSzvJEqXeQI9b5nSwD5wUDbxVyqaFJF2WtfqZdiXyiBT8XIGsW3ovNOzpCCDCvqC96yw0R 7uM4/59JjSO0yk5rasYoCGvx7scjV2XBq8BKTyMwO57z0p0YjyPf9Dm7d2X4PrVL2DkRIGgjY 6peCYf1mMEL2xOScHgaduHuR21JdiJJKycZQ3Fica3qelQDdx0LTks1x16TLLPNP23Nu3wGRW 55UynTfhFAGzfKl1yxQekoa0lt9NAxvp5FnLH5efxHQN9ylW8Ohp+8kRoazrz9moS0SORsNtm +bsTX8VzX/uw1YyDbbCRPpP+TzTK6oDFl2s9JEPaCCCvxhyzqzcxv9Q2zkktah38O0QuxhXmx +QYRKuN1RC15K475GScTZ7TEIGgrZdALjLkAk3d5p8vuD1obJxfXJzSGPdajfQ/OgFH/PUtfd E/+zBrMYpZiQ4iIv/FFSDM3KDWAdzqzNy+9pK6g4OfLZyn+YDSNr3yh3vzhwxDc2x339aGLfF QN0UQjR0Ko+e3jRZAmcLUUx4uYcfW7NIXUH04ptXzsvLE0eWMSEHpktjSI3tZ8i8LDZD73OGz VyvFwEAV7/ZpA5DzoliZd+6kGHn+aVCReDZunVhSztwwSiSjS7Bp8qe3yYzizndsUKqeYqaLC 8OR6G/X9KA8AKZgdkcVgDKACIO5mD5txz+VpMeJ60T5feCu1P9KzpVfQacYpXM/Ms0xzh2NPM yPjQERNltAymfMY2/Dk26iV8KhL57CbyV6+j7xtkAEcXnLfHymv4cTwnWu2z/csPjiODdd6Pe 0Qcv3lgq81p/NOIN5rKx3jyq+7yO5dRJ3+GHy++z46BIsGyZ3ErjWOJgcWZT8s X-BeenThere: linux-aspeed@lists.ozlabs.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: Linux ASPEED SoC development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Stefan M Schaeckeler Errors-To: linux-aspeed-bounces+incoming=patchwork.ozlabs.org@lists.ozlabs.org Sender: "Linux-aspeed" From: Stefan M Schaeckeler Add support for the Aspeed AST2500 SoC EDAC driver. Changes since v1: - Addressed all cosmetic issues - Fixed (un-)recoverable address calculation in reg58 and reg5c - Removed status field from the example device tree binding - Added little more text to Kconfig Stefan M Schaeckeler (2): EDAC: Add Aspeed AST2500 EDAC driver dt-bindings: edac: Aspeed AST2500 .../bindings/edac/aspeed-sdram-edac.txt | 25 ++ MAINTAINERS | 6 + arch/arm/boot/dts/aspeed-g5.dtsi | 7 + drivers/edac/Kconfig | 8 + drivers/edac/Makefile | 1 + drivers/edac/aspeed_edac.c | 421 ++++++++++++++++++ 6 files changed, 468 insertions(+) create mode 100644 Documentation/devicetree/bindings/edac/aspeed-sdram-edac.txt create mode 100644 drivers/edac/aspeed_edac.c